Underground coal gasification modelling in deep coal seams and its implications to carbon storage in a climate-conscious world

Liangliang Jiang et al.

Summary: Underground coal gasification (UCG) has the prospect of tapping deep coal seams and reducing carbon emissions. However, there is limited experience in deep UCG development. This study constructed a large-scale 3D UCG model with an improved method and considered the effect of double-diffusive natural convection. The results showed that the improved method was beneficial for the development of UCG cavities in deep coal seams, and double-diffusive natural convection played an important role in cavity development and overall UCG performance.

Experimental simulations of methane-oriented underground coal gasification using hydrogen- The effect of coal rank and gasification pressure on the hydrogasification process

Krzysztof Kapusta et al.

Summary: This paper presents a series of surface experimental simulations of methane-oriented underground coal gasification using hydrogen as gasification medium. The experiments demonstrated that the physicochemical properties of coal considerably affect the hydrogasification process and the feasibility of methane-rich gas production was initially demonstrated. However, further techno-economic studies are necessary to assess the economic feasibility of methane production using this process.

INTERNATIONAL JOURNAL OF HYDROGEN ENERGY (2023)

The evolution characteristics of bituminous coal in the process of pyrolysis at elevated pressure

Wenda Zhang et al.

Summary: The study reports the formation rules of gas products and evolution characteristics of physicochemical structure during the pyrolysis of Shenhua bituminous coal under different pressures, temperatures, and residence times. Increasing pressure, temperature, and residence time promote the release of carbon and nitrogen-containing gases, affecting the physicochemical structure of the char products.
